Organizing Neutrality Agreement to Cover 3,000 after Arbitration Win
News
November 8, 2007
An arbitrator in Texas refused to buy management's double-talk and ruled that Windstream Communications must abide by the provisions of a neutrality and expedited election agreement CWA had with parent company Valor Communications prior to a corporate spin off last year.

After Crew is Sickened, AFA-CWA Renews Call for Cabin Air Testing
News
November 8, 2007
Citing a report this week of a US Airways flight crew being hospitalized for symptoms of apparent carbon monoxide poisoning, AFA-CWA renewed its call for legislation to provide for research on aircraft cabin air quality.
Say-on-Pay' at Verizon a Major CWA Victory
News
November 8, 2007
The pay and perks of Verizon executives face closer scrutiny from shareholders starting in 2009, a major victory for CWA, the IBEW, AFL-CIO and retirees who worked for corporate governance reform.
CWA Charges Embarq's Slashing of Retiree Health Care is Illegal
News
November 8, 2007
CWA this week filed unfair labor practice charges with the NLRB against Embarq, contending the company's announced plan to slash retiree health benefits for future as well as current retirees is a unilateral change that ignores its obligation to bargain with the union.
